Proactive Security Market Industry: Shifting from Reactive Defense to Predictive Protection
The Proactive Security Market Industry represents a fundamental paradigm shift in cybersecurity, moving organizations from reactive, incident-response models to predictive, preventative strategies that anticipate and neutralize threats before they materialize. The industry landscape encompasses a comprehensive ecosystem of advanced technologies including Intrusion Detection Systems, Network Security Solutions, Endpoint Security Solutions, Identity and Access Management, and Security Information and Event Management that collectively enable organizations to identify vulnerabilities and predict attack vectors. The modern proactive security solution is characterized by its ability to unify asset visibility, prioritize remediation actions, and orchestrate response across the entire security infrastructure. Organizations are increasingly leveraging attack simulation tools within the proactive security market to identify vulnerabilities before real-world exploitation, enabling stronger defense strategies and faster incident response.
The deployment strategies within the Proactive Security Market Industry have become increasingly diverse to accommodate different organizational needs and infrastructure preferences. Cloud-based solutions are gaining significant traction, offering scalability and flexibility essential for modern security operations, while on-premises deployments maintain relevance for organizations with stringent data sovereignty requirements. The industry serves a wide range of end-users including Banking Financial Services and Insurance, Government and Defense, Healthcare, Retail, and Telecommunications, each with unique security requirements and compliance obligations. The shift toward integrated security platforms reflects the growing recognition that siloed security tools are no longer sufficient to combat sophisticated, multi-vector attacks.
The integration capabilities of Proactive Security solutions are fundamental to their value proposition, enabling organizations to create unified security ecosystems that span their entire digital footprint. The integ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ning is transforming threat detection capabilities, enabling faster identification of vulnerabilities and more effective mitigation strategies. This integration is essential for achieving a seamless experience across network security, endpoint protection, and cloud security, which are key components of modern proactive security solutions. The Proactive Security Market is likely to continue evolving as companies seek to stay ahead of emerging risks, with collaboration between technology providers and end-users essential in developing tailored solutions that address specific security challenges.
The implementation strategies for Proactive Security solutions are evolving to support faster deployment, higher adoption, and improved security outcomes. A phased approach, starting with critical assets and high-risk areas that offer immediate value while building organizational capabilities over time, is often recommended. The focus on automated threat hunting, real-time analytics, and vulnerability management is critical for successful adoption. Organizations that adopt comprehensive proactive security strategies—while addressing integration complexity, skill development, and organizational change—are best positioned to maximize the value of their investment. The Proactive Security Market was valued at 34.6 USD Billion in 2024 and is projected to grow to 84.98 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a CAGR of 8.51%.
